Output 80e654fc1032a7718c6826304bf0d1b61ce376bcf889a008ff458427a56acaad:0

value
10899000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15ec49b5d29a7cab6000aba127f295dab3be0465 OP_EQUAL
address
33gwB9PVQgLxSZQaQgovLiSTG1PSeFrhMx
transaction
80e654fc1032a7718c6826304bf0d1b61ce376bcf889a008ff458427a56acaad
confirmations
435823
spent
true